Description - Flavours of England: Puddings by Gilli Davies

When is a pudding a pudding and not a dessert? This can be a vexing question to many, but to the English, a pudding feels homely while a dessert is generally more sophisticated.

Complete with information on the history of the dishes, delve into this collection of recipes to recreate a range of traditional sweet courses and sample new or familiar flavours that have remained popular for centuries.

Recipes include:

Eton Mess

Queen of Puddings

Damson Crumble

and more.
